The Pancha Bhoota Sthalams represent the five essential elements of nature: Earth, Water, Fire, Air, and Space. These temples hold not only local but also significant spiritual importance, as they embody the essence of worship and devotion to Lord Shiva. The tour covers five sacred Shiva temples that are intrinsically linked to these elements: Ekambareswarar Temple in Kanchipuram representing Earth, Jambukeswarar Temple in Tiruchirappalli symbolizing Water, Annamalaiyar Temple in Tiruvannamalai as Fire, Kalahasthi Temple embodying Air, and Nagapattinam Temple representing Space. This historic city, revered as one of India's seven Moksha-puris, offers a multitude of temples that highlight the grandeur of ancient South Indian architecture. With a professional travel planner, pilgrims can explore significant landmarks including the magnificent Ekambareswarar Temple, dedicated to Lord Shiva. The temple is unique for its 2,400-year-old mango tree, believed to represent the five elements.
